Holding


Your camper toilet holds all of the away in three tanks. When flushed, the squander is separated into tanks depending on why type of squander it is. Solid waste goes to a black water tank, while liquid waste goes to a gray water tank. There is a third tank that is kept for fresh water to be used while flushing. The black and gray tanks, however, need chemicals to help break down waste and combat the smell that may be associate with them.When your camper toilet is full, then it is necessary to find a dump station, commonly found at gas stations and campsites. It is recommended that you wait until the tanks are full before your empty them, as it creates the necessary water pressure to effectively remove the waste. You will find a gauge on the side of the camper, where the hose is located, that will tell you how full the tanks are. The tank hose is connected to the dump station, and a valve is then opened that uses vacuum force to suck all of the waste from your camper to receive rid of it.



Chemicals like formaldehyde, bronopol or nitrates are all effective and mostly biodegradable. Waste is held in the tanks until it is full and you are ready to remove or pump the waste out.
